Abstract

Non-communicable diseases (NCDs) are diseases that occur not due to infection but are diseases that are not transmitted from person to person. This is because PTM is the most common cause of death in the world at 74%. KKN students in Lokki Village, carried out a free health check-up work program including Socialization on Non-Communicable Diseases, checking blood pressure, uric acid, cholesterol and blood sugar, with the participation of 76 people from adults to the elderly with the aim of so that the prevalence rate of non-communicable disease cases can decrease in the Lokki Village community. This program was implemented on November 7 2024 at the Lokki Village Saniri Hall to carry out socialization and at the Teratai Community Health Center (PUSTU) to carry out examinations and counseling. The methods used are socialization, physical examination and counseling. The results of this activity obtained blood pressure above normal (hypertension) by 39.4%, high blood sugar (hyperglycemia) by 5.9%, high uric acid examination (hyperuresemia) by 33.3%, and high cholesterol (hypercholesterolemia) by 9.2% of the 76 people who participated. Based on this data, routine checks are needed to control and prevent the high number of non-communicable diseases in Lokki Village.
